From the promoter:

Roll up, roll up! This is your second and last chance to hear Ernest Hilbert (of the Contemporary Poetry Review and E-Verse Radio) read in London this year.

As Ernie’s first collection is called (and, indeed, is) Sixty Sonnets, this evening we will Reclaim the Sonnet, Stoke Newington-style! Lemon Monkey is a new venue with an evening license and delicious food.

A sonnet (possibly a Shakespeare’s 99th) of sonneteers will read either one or two poems each. Some are formalists, others less so, and one or two frankly experimental. Ernie himself invented the Hilbertian Sonnet which some US poets are now adopting.

We say: “If you say it’s a sonnet, it’s a sonnet. But you have to mean it.” Lemon Monkey Café is just by the end of Church Street, 2 mins walk from Stoke Newington main line station (from Liverpool St via Bethnal Green), and a short bus ride from Seven Sisters tube (Victoria Line).
